Tall Ghana expands following successful launch in Accra
Following its debut “The Elevated Circle: Tall Ghana” event on May 21, 2026, in Osu, Accra, and a second Accra edition on June 4 in East Legon, Tall Ghana continues to expand. It has also announced that a third gathering is already planned for July 20 at Starbites in Kumasi.
What began as a simple idea to connect Ghana’s tall community has now evolved into a growing social and networking movement bringing together professionals, entrepreneurs, creatives, members of the diaspora, and individuals looking to connect through shared experiences.
Founded by media personality, documentary producer, and cultural strategist Ivy Prosper, Tall Ghana was inspired by the daily experiences of living as a tall person. She’s been 6 feet 1 inches tall since she was 15 years old. She was also inspired by the growing international popularity of height-based social events and by the recognition that many tall Ghanaians share similar experiences navigating everyday life.
“I thought about this in 2022 but held the idea until now. This was the perfect time,” Ms. Prosper said.
“What we discovered is that this isn’t just about height. It’s about community. People enjoyed meeting others who understood their experiences and wanted opportunities to continue those conversations. Right after the first event ended, people were asking when the next one was going to take place.”
Tall Ghana encourages participation from men who are 6 feet and above and women who are 5 feet 9 inches and above, although the events are open to everyone. “We had three short ladies join us to experience what it was like to be around all these tall people in one place.”
From standing out in crowds and struggling to find properly fitting clothing to constantly being asked whether they play basketball, tall individuals often share common experiences that transcend profession, age, and background. The events provide an opportunity for those experiences to become the foundation for new friendships, professional relationships, and community connections.
The concept arrives at a time when niche communities and curated social experiences are becoming increasingly popular around the world. Rather than traditional networking events, many people are seeking spaces built around shared lifestyles, identities, and interests.
Guests attending the June 4 event can expect an evening of networking, social activities, entertainment, music, conversation, and community-building in a relaxed environment.
Organizers say the vision extends far beyond Accra. Future plans include regional meetups, wellness experiences, fashion collaborations, travel experiences, and the possibility of expanding into a broader platform across the continent. As interest continues to grow, Tall Ghana is positioning itself as more than an event series it’s becoming a community.
